Output dd96d350f74b5443531d7661bad5d4f47d9cad6bb4dcf90da50a54eb938c69f1:8

value
41084634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ad62554e295198b895f824a399658f0867d99b OP_EQUAL
address
MJdNzp9rxpAstFf5WKsXNENVECh8MR5ztU
transaction
dd96d350f74b5443531d7661bad5d4f47d9cad6bb4dcf90da50a54eb938c69f1
spent
true